One organization that has taken this burden into consideration when thinking of strategies that would help increase and diversify their audience is the Playwrights Horizons, a long standing theater that has been a part of the off-Broadway community for many years now and is dedicated to showcasing new works, helping many to make their entry into the Great White Way. Playwrights Horizons has served as a intricate part of growth of theater through the launch and assistance of many theaters artists and their work.
It has now also launched a program called Playtime! at Playwrights Horizons to facilitate the attendance of to the theater of the audience who love it but can’t often enjoy it because of difficulties with childcare. For a flat fee of $15 per child (ages 4-12), theater goers can rely on the wonderful care of their children provided by Studio Sitters, a group of “Artsitters”, or artists who have made it their goal to incorporate creativity and fun in the time spent with your kids.
My husband and I recently brought in our 4 and 5 year old to Playtime! so that we could see one of the first performances of Kin, now playing at the theater till April 17.
The performance itself was magnificent. Directed by Sam Gold (Circle Mirror Transformation, Tigers Be Still, Duak Rings a Bell) and brilliantly written by Bathsheba Doran. Emotional on so many levels, with a captivating and ever-changing scene that transport you geographically and through time.
As I watched this wonderful performance only once did my mind wonder to my kids, how they were, if they were having fun. But I was immediately comforted by the fact that they were just upstairs and I was but a tap on the shoulder away.
I should not have worried. When I went to get them they were full of energy and excitement, with a collection of art work that had creating in the time I had enjoyed the show and with fun songs they had learned to share.

Playwrights Horizons is hoping other local theaters will partner with the program and offer it to their audiences. It would certainly help many families who enjoy the theater, but not the hassle of arranging for a sitter to get there, and it would help our beloved theater community in striving and continuing to deliver the great works from great artists.
